摘要: DS18B20是一款常用的数字温度传感器,采用单总线通讯,输出为数字信号。 在使用DS18B20进行测温时,一般都采用电源常通的形式,即永远接通电源。我们知道,任何器件在通电的情况下都会产生热量。这个热量与供电电压、电流,有的与器件材料、内部构造也有一定的关系。 所以,曾想到对18B20的电源采用间 阅读全文
posted @ 2026-03-14 17:48 lmn2005 阅读(1) 评论(0) 推荐(0)
摘要: 在某论坛上,曾有坛友在测试STC8G内置IRC 32KHz,刚好手头有芯片STC8G1K08-SOP8,于是直接焊接到SOP8转DIP8板子上,就可以进行测试了。 STC8G内部时钟结构如下图: 从图中可以看出,想启用内部32KHz,就必须CLKSEL=0x03;但是单单CLKSEL=0x03是无法 阅读全文
posted @ 2026-02-28 17:44 lmn2005 阅读(8) 评论(0) 推荐(0)
摘要: 一、简介 Air001是合宙早期的一款TSSOP20封装的MCU,采用高性能的32位ARM®Cortex®-M0+内核,内置32Kbytes的Flash和4Kbytes的RAM。芯片集 成多路USART、IIC、SPI等通讯外设,5个16bit定时器以及1路12bit ADC和2路比较器。(摘自lu 阅读全文
posted @ 2026-02-15 10:54 lmn2005 阅读(10) 评论(0) 推荐(0)
摘要: 最近搞一次电子制作,设计PCB、打样、焊接完成后才发现,数码管没有加入限流电阻!想着要不启用数码管,又不太合适,想着重新打样又觉得太浪费。 单片机用的是CH552,CH552内部已经集成上拉电阻,上拉电阻的阻值大约是4K(具体可以参考文章:https://www.cnblogs.com/jyxxkj 阅读全文
posted @ 2026-02-05 10:56 lmn2005 阅读(5) 评论(0) 推荐(0)
摘要: CH552属于51内核的单片机,其引脚在复位后为传统的51普通IO,可以输出高电平但电流不大,也可以接受低电平状态输入检测。而推挽输出状态电流是最大的。除了这两种模式外,还有浮空输入,无上拉和开漏输入输出,无上拉这两种模式。 以P1口为例,官方例程的端口配置如下: /**************** 阅读全文
posted @ 2026-02-01 16:23 lmn2005 阅读(9) 评论(0) 推荐(0)
摘要: 近两天用STM32F103C6T6A制作一个电子钟,用STM32CubeMX生成工程后,直接用HAL库中的设定日期和时间的函数来初始化时间。 设定和读取当前时间用的函数是: HAL_StatusTypeDef HAL_RTC_SetTime(RTC_HandleTypeDef *hrtc, RTC_ 阅读全文
posted @ 2026-01-31 13:39 lmn2005 阅读(18) 评论(0) 推荐(0)
摘要: 程序简单测试之后,就开始测试电容降压式的功能。不敢大意,先把CH32V003拆了,只留下电容降压式稳压电路。 通电220V,结果量不到电压。通过复核电路,发现在设计时缺少了一个二极管,就是下图中的D5: 本想参考网上的设计,把稳压管放到D5的位置的, 结果直接烧管!估计是这稳压管功率太小了吧! 用上 阅读全文
posted @ 2026-01-29 14:08 lmn2005 阅读(5) 评论(0) 推荐(0)
摘要: 单片机通过串口打印信息,可以使用printf内置函数。 下面以STM32F103C6T6A为例,说一说如何通过STM32CubeMX生成一个可以使用printf的工程。 1、打开STM32CubeMX,新建项目,选择STM32F103C6T6A单片机 2、将PB12配置成输出模式(用于闪灯)。 点击 阅读全文
posted @ 2026-01-27 13:40 lmn2005 阅读(8) 评论(0) 推荐(0)
摘要: 在用STM32F103C6T6A配合STM32CubeMX进行实验的过程中,发现了两点以前没有测试过的现象。 1、用STM32CubeMX生成简易的点灯工程后进行测试,开始是不启用外接晶振的,后来因为想使用USB功能,试了一下启用外接晶振。设置如下: 下载了程序,在实际电路尚未接入晶振的情况下,居然 阅读全文
posted @ 2026-01-26 19:12 lmn2005 阅读(4) 评论(0) 推荐(0)
摘要: 一、安装 以前用过STM32CubeMX,但是很久以前的事,现在几乎忘记得一干二净了。 今天,先从官网上下来了一个最新版本的STM32CubeMX。当前最新版本是6.16.1,以前用过的版本是6.8.0的。 新版本的STM32CubeMX安装后运行,觉得界面与以前的大同小异。不过,支持的型号和功能应 阅读全文
posted @ 2026-01-26 17:55 lmn2005 阅读(24) 评论(0) 推荐(0)